Healthcare Provider Training Gaps in Iowa
In Iowa, statistics reveal a concerning gap in healthcare provider awareness and responsiveness to domestic violence and sexual assault cases. According to recent surveys, approximately 35% of healthcare professionals report feeling unprepared to screen for or address signs of abuse during patient interactions. This creates a critical risk for victims who may not receive the immediate support they need within clinical environments, where seeking help may first occur.
Who Should Apply for Funding in Iowa
This funding opportunity is geared towards healthcare organizations, educational institutions, and advocacy groups working to enhance training programs for healthcare providers in Iowa. Eligible applicants include hospitals, clinics, medical training facilities, and non-profit organizations that focus on delivering care to victims of abuse. Proposals will be evaluated based on the organization's commitment to improving provider knowledge and skills in recognizing the signs of domestic violence and taking appropriate action.
Application Reality for Healthcare Initiatives
Applicants must conduct a needs assessment to identify specific training deficits within their organization. Applications should outline a detailed plan for training implementation, including methodologies for educating providers on effective communication and resource referral for patients facing domestic violence concerns. Successful applications will demonstrate a commitment to ongoing evaluation, adapting training based on participant feedback and emerging best practices within the field.
Impact of Enhanced Training in Iowa's Healthcare Network
This initiative will lead to improved recognition and handling of domestic violence cases in Iowa's healthcare settings. By equipping providers with the necessary tools and knowledge, the aim is to create a healthcare environment where victims feel safe to disclose their experiences and receive appropriate referrals to support services. In turn, this can significantly increase the number of survivors accessing vital resources and ultimately facilitate a pathway towards healing.
